        Soybean meal substitution by dehulled lupine (Lupinus angustifolius) with enzymes in broiler diets

        Fredy Mera-Zuniga,Arturo Pro-Martinez,Juan F Zamora-Natera,Eliseo Sosa-Montes,Juan D Guerrero-Rodriguez,Sergio I Mendoza-Pedroza,Juan M Cuca-Garcia,Rosa M Lopez-Romero,David Chan-Diaz,Carlos M Becerri 아세아·태평양축산학회 2019 Animal Bioscience Vol.32 No.4

        Objective: Evaluate the effects of i) dehulling of lupine seed on chemical composition and apparent metabolizable energy (AME) and ii) soybean meal substitution by dehulled lupine seed in broiler diets with enzymes on productive performance, size of digestive organs and welfare-related variables. Methods: Experiment 1, chemical composition and AME were determined in whole and dehulled lupine seed. Experiment 2, two hundred eighty-eight one-day-old male Ross 308 broilers were used. The experimental diets were maize-soybean meal (MS), MS with enzymes (MSE) and maize-dehulled lupine seed with enzymes (MLE). Diets were assigned to the experimental units under a completely randomized design (eight replicates per diet). The body weight (BW) gain, feed intake, feed conversion, digestive organ weights, gait score, latency to lie down and valgus/varus angulation were evaluated. Results: The dehulling process increased protein (25.0% to 31.1%), AME (5.9 to 8.8 MJ/kg) and amino acid contents. The BW gain of broilers fed the MLE diet was similar (p>0.05) to that of those fed the MS diet, but lower than that of those fed the MSE diet. Feed intake of broilers fed the MLE diet was higher (p<0.05) than that of those fed the MS diet and similar (p>0.05) to those fed the MSE diet. Feed conversion of broilers fed the MLE diet was 8.0% and 8.7% higher (p<0.05) than that of those fed the MS and MSE diets, respectively. Broilers fed the MLE diet had the highest (p<0.05) relative proventriculus and gizzard weights, but had poor welfare-related variables. Conclusion: It is possible to substitute soybean meal by dehulled lupine seed with enzymes in broiler diets, obtaining similar BW gains in broilers fed the MLE and MS diets; however, a higher feed intake is required. Additionally, the MLE diet reduced welfare-related variables.

        기획특집 : 아시아-태평양 지역의 이주와 트랜스내셔널리즘 ; 남미의 한인 교포 1.5세 : 초국가적 상호작용의 재발견

        Carolina Mera 국제비교한국학회 2010 비교한국학 Comparative Korean Studies Vol.18 No.3

        본 연구에서는 북 남미 지역의 한인 교포 1.5세의 이동성을 초국가적 이민 현상을 중심으로 살펴보았다. 연구문제는 남미의 이민자들이 직업적, 전문적 기회를 확대하기 위하여 어떻게 초국적이민자 네트워크를 활용하여 새로운 이민도시에 적응하고 있는가에 초점을 맞추었다. 이민 1세대 또는 이민 2세대와는 구분되는 개념으로, 한국에서 학교를 다닌 경험이 있는 이민 1.5세대의 이동경로를 그들의 사회적 자본, 문화적 자본의 측면에서 분석하였다. 초국적 이민자 네트워크와 이민 1.5세대의 양문화주의적 자본은 재이민의 유형에 영향을 미치고, 이러한 이동성은 이들의 새로운 이민국에서 긍정적으로 작용할 것으로 추정하였다. 민속지적 연구를 통하여 본 연구에서는 공동체적 사회적 자본이 두 번째 이민국으로의 이동과 그 후 정착에 어떠한 역할을 하는지 알아보았다. 이들의 교육적 배경, 스페인어 또는 포르투갈어 등 언어능력 등 문화 자본은 그 후 직업적 측면에서 스페인어권 공동체를 찾아들어가는 데 도움이 되고 있었다. 즉, 사회적 자본과 문화적 자본이 재이 민국 에서의 각각의 역할을 수행하고 있었다. 1.5세대의 제3국으로의 이민에 대한 관찰을 통하여 본 연구에서는 문화적응 또는 통합에 대한 기존의 논의에 대한 새로운 문제제기를 할 수 있었다. 양 문화 주의적 정체성을 지닌 이민자들은 그들의 문화정체성을 유지하면서 이민자 공동체에서의 정체성을 재확인하지만, 그들의 일 또는 전문 분야에서는 이민국에서 터득한 문화자을 적극 활용하여 새로운 국가에서의 삶의 조건을 영유하는데 활용하고 있다는 점을 발견하게 되었다. This article explores the migration of young members of e 1.5 generation, who are the protagonists of significant regional mobility in South and North America. The main research question in this article is as follows: we do transnational diasporas networks promote mobility in arch of better work and professional opportunities and improve the prospects for migrants arriving in their new cities? I hypothesize that the transnational networks and the bicultural capital (of young Koreans) influences the pattern of re-emigration, promoting the mobility and allowing migrants to achieve better prospects in their new homes. Community social capital provides networks that support the move and the initial stages of life in the new location, whereas cultural capital, particularly in the form of educational qualifications and the ability to speak Spanish or Portuguese, helps migrants find a place in certain Spanish-speaking niches and ensures a certain degree of professional success. These factors suggest that transnational networks promote mobility in the search for better professional and work opportunities and make adjusting to life a new city easier and more efficient. The re-emigration of 1.5-generation Korean professionals facilitates the ongoing debate related to the integration or assimilation of migrants in the diasporas processes, as bicultural migrants maintain their ethnic identity in terms of ethnic attachment and ethnic solidarity but professionally acclimate themselves to working conditions in their new country.

        Explaining Argentina’s Regional Trade Policy-making in 1999

        Laura Gomez Mera 서울대학교 국제학연구소 2005 Journal of International and Area Studies Vol.12 No.2

          This article examines Argentine regional trade policy behavior in 1999. It seeks to account for the decision to defect from regional commitments by establishing non-tariff barrier restrictions on footwear products from its main regional trade partner Brazil. These unilateral measures triggered one of the most serious bilateral disputes between the two countries in recent years. The article challenges conventional interpretations of the origins of the crisis. It argues that defection reflected a convergence of interests between the private sector, which feared the competitiveness effects of the Brazilian devaluation, and Argentine macroeconomic policy-makers. The tension between the latter, supporting the unilateral measures and the foreign policy elite, in turn, was crucial in shaping Argentina"s final position in the crisis. Argentina"s decision to press the private sector for the negotiation of a voluntary export agreement and to eventually withdraw the measures reflected a balance or compromised between the hardliners at the Ministry of Economy and the MERCOSUR-committed foreign policy makers and diplomats.

      • Resonance Raman spectroscopic study of the interaction between Co(II)rrinoids and the ATP:corrinoid adenosyltransferase PduO from Lactobacillus reuteri

        Park, Kiyoung,Mera, Paola E.,Escalante-Semerena, Jorge C.,Brunold, Thomas C. Springer-Verlag 2016 Journal of biological inorganic chemistry Vol.21 No.5

        <P>The human-type ATP:corrinoid adenosyltransferase PduO from Lactobacillus reuteri (LrPduO) catalyzes the adenosylation of Co(II)rrinoids to generate adenosylcobalamin (AdoCbl) or adenosylcobinamide (AdoCbi(+)). This process requires the formation of 'supernucleophilic' Co(I)rrinoid intermediates in the enzyme active site which are properly positioned to abstract the adeonsyl moiety from co-substrate ATP. Previous magnetic circular dichroism (MCD) spectroscopic and X-ray crystallographic analyses revealed that LrPduO achieves the thermodynamically challenging reduction of Co(II)rrinoids by displacing the axial ligand with a non-coordinating phenylalanine residue to produce a four-coordinate species. However, relatively little is currently known about the interaction between the tetradentate equatorial ligand of Co(II)rrinoids (the corrin ring) and the enzyme active site. To address this issue, we have collected resonance Raman (rR) data of Co(II)rrinoids free in solution and bound to the LrPduO active site. The relevant resonance-enhanced vibrational features of the free Co(II)rrinoids are assigned on the basis of rR intensity calculations using density functional theory to establish a suitable framework for interpreting rR spectral changes that occur upon Co(II)rrinoid binding to the LrPduO/ATP complex in terms of structural perturbations of the corrin ring. To complement our rR data, we have also obtained MCD spectra of Co(II)rrinoids bound to LrPduO complexed with the ATP analogue UTP. Collectively, our results provide compelling evidence that in the LrPduO active site, the corrin ring of Co(II)rrinoids is firmly locked in place by several amino acid side chains so as to facilitate the dissociation of the axial ligand.</P>

      • Stiffness Analysis of Crank Motion Task using Musculoskeletal Model with Sixmuscles

        Nobutomo MATSUNAGA,Ryohei MERA,Hiroshi OKAJIMA,Shigeyasu KAWAJI 제어로봇시스템학회 2009 제어로봇시스템학회 국제학술대회 논문집 Vol.2009 No.8

        It is important to clarify that how are the stiffness and the torque of human arm controlled in the interaction with the environment. Traditionally, the stiffness of human arm has been measured by adding perturbation. However, it is difficult to measure the stiffnes sinisotonic movements with various loads, because the perturbation provides the unexpected stiffness increase by an tagonistic muscles. In this paper, the musculoskeletal model with six musclesis used to estimate the joint torque and stiffness incrank rotation tasks. The parameters of the model are estimated by experiments. And the pre-programmed reaction for the predictable load torque are evaluated.

        Participation of COX-1 and COX-2 in the contractile effect of phenylephrine in prepubescent and old rats

        Gustavo Guevara-Balcazar,Israel Ramirez-Sanchez,Elvia Mera-Jimenez,Ivan Rubio-Gayosso,Maria Eugenia Aguilar-Najera,Maria C. Castillo-Hernandez 대한약리학회 2017 The Korean Journal of Physiology & Pharmacology Vol.21 No.4

        Vascular reactivity can be influenced by the vascular region, animal age, and pathologies present. Prostaglandins (produced by COX-1 and COX-2) play an important role in the contractile response to phenylephrine in the abdominal aorta of young rats. Although these COXs are found in many tissues, their distribution and role in vascular reactivity are not clear. At a vascular level, they take part in the homeostasis functions involved in many physiological and pathologic processes (e.g., arterial pressure and inflammatory processes). The aim of this study was to analyze changes in the contractile response to phenylephrine of thoracic/abdominal aorta and the coronary artery during aging in rats. Three groups of rats were formed and sacrificed at three distinct ages: prepubescent, young and old adult. The results suggest that there is a higher participation of prostanoids in the contractile effect of phenylephrine in pre-pubescent rats, and a lower participation of the same in old rats. Contrarily, there seems to be a higher participation of prostanoids in the contractile response of the coronary artery of older than pre-pubescent rats. Considering that the changes in the expression of COX-2 were similar for the three age groups and the two tissues tested, and that expression of COX-1 is apparently greater in older rats, COX-1 and COX-2 may lose functionality in relation to their corresponding receptors during aging in rats.
